全面解析数字货币地址:类型、构成及安全性
一、数字货币地址的基础知识
在数字货币的世界中,地址是进行交易的关键要素之一。简单来说,数字货币地址就像是银行账户号码,用于识别和接收数字资产。但与传统银行账户不同,数字货币地址通常是由一串字母和数字组成的代码,具有较强的随机性和匿名性。数字货币的地址不仅仅用于接收和发送交易,它在整个区块链生态中,扮演着重要的角色。
二、数字货币地址的类型
数字货币地址主要有几种不同类型,每种类型都有其特定的用途和特点:
- 比特币地址:比特币地址通常由26到35个字符组成,以“1”、“3”或“bc1”开头,分别对应不同类型的地址类型,如P2PKH和P2SH。
- 以太坊地址:以太坊地址是一个40个字符的十六进制字符串,以“0x”开头。以太坊地址用于识别发送方和接收方,也可以用于智能合约的交互。
- 莱特币地址:莱特币地址与比特币类似,但通常以“L”或“M”开头,功能相同,用于接收和发送莱特币。
- ERC-20地址:专门用于以太坊区块链上的代币,这些地址都是以“0x”开头的40个字符十六进制字符串。
三、数字货币地址的构成与生成
数字货币地址是由公钥经过哈希算法生成的。首先,用户生成一对密钥,即公钥和私钥。公钥用于生成地址,而私钥则需要妥善保存,在进行交易时用来签名,确保交易的安全性。
具体生成过程如下:
- 生成一对公钥和私钥。
- 将公钥通过两次不同的哈希算法进行处理,通常是SHA-256和RIPEMD-160。
- 将结果转换成可读的地址格式,并添加适当的前缀。
这一过程保证了生成地址的唯一性与安全性,降低了被攻击的可能性。
四、数字货币地址的安全性
虽然数字货币地址本身是安全的,但用户的操作则可能导致资产被盗或丢失。这些常见的安全隐患包括:
- 私钥泄露:绝对不可与任何人分享,包括朋友或家人。保护私钥是确保资产安全的关键。
- 钓鱼攻击:攻击者可能会伪造钱包或交易所的网站,窃取用户的登录信息和私钥。
- 交易确认:在进行交易时,用户需确认交易信息,以避免错误发送到不正确的地址。
为了提高安全性,用户可以考虑使用硬件钱包来存储资产,确保私钥不在线存储,从而降低被黑客攻击的风险。
五、常见问题解答
数字货币地址可以公开吗?
数字货币地址在技术上是可以公开的,任何人都可以查看区块链上的交易记录。但从安全和隐私的角度,建议用户仅在必需的情况下分享地址。例如,用户可以在接收款项时分享自己的地址,但在其他时刻最好保持地址的私密性。
如何保护自己的数字货币地址?
保护数字货币地址的关键在于妥善管理私钥和相关信息。首先,务必要将私钥保存在安全的地方,避免在线存储。其次,使用两步验证及其他安全措施,确保只有自己能够操作钱包。此外,定期检查交易记录,及时发现异常也是保护资产的有效手段。
我可以更改我的数字货币地址吗?
通常情况下,数字货币地址在生成后是固定的,用户不能直接更改它。不过,用户可以创建新的地址来替代旧地址。在某些钱包中,可以生成新的接收地址,而旧地址上的余额依然存在,用户可以选择将资产转移到新地址。
数字货币的地址会过时吗?
一般而言,数字货币的地址不会过时。区块链技术的设计确保了地址的长期有效性。但是,一些旧版地址可能会因为协议升级而不再被支持,因此用户需要关注他们使用的钱包或交易所的更新。建议用户定期关注相关消息,以保持资产的安全和流动。
总结
数字货币地址作为区块链生态系统中的重要组成部分,承载着交易和资产流动的基本功能。理解数字货币地址的类型、构成、安全性以及如何保护自己的地址,是每一个数字货币用户不可或缺的知识。希望本文能够帮助用户更好地了解并操作数字货币,为资产安全保驾护航。